DPZ – Broadening its Menu and Relevant Dayparts

08/27/08 03:19PM EDT
Domino’s recently announced the national roll-out of its new oven baked sandwiches, priced at $4.99. I have written about the success Subway has had with its $5 price point from a traffic standpoint so these new sandwiches could really help to drive traffic for DPZ (relative to the overall QSR pizza category, which has experienced negative traffic trends for the last 6 quarters, according to NPD data).

Although the sandwiches will not generate the same margins as a one-topping pizza, they should provide incremental business during the lunch daypart and add to the overall ticket. President of Domino's USA Patrick Doyle stated, "This launch springboards Domino's into the lunch business by providing a product that is high quality, priced right and aimed at convenience-minded people without a lot of time. Of course, sandwiches are also available any time our stores are open.”
